Exposition Picasso

After One sheet, This is a vintage lithographic poster for the "Exposition Picasso" held at the Musée des Arts Décoratifs in Paris from June to October 1955 . The poster features a reproduction of Pablo Picasso's 1944 painting, "Buste de femme au chapeau bleu" (Bust of a woman in a blue hat), which is also known by the name of his muse, Dora Maar. Here are some additional details about the poster and the original painting: Exhibition: The exhibition was held at the Pavillon de Marsan of the Musée des Arts Décoratifs in Paris. Painting Subject: The woman depicted in the painting is Dora Maar, a French photographer, painter, and Picasso's lover and muse. Creation: The original lithographic poster was printed in colors on smooth wove paper. Some versions were part of a limited edition run of 500 copies. Print Details: The original posters were printed by Mourlot, a famous lithographic printer in Paris.
